About Egbert Figgemeier

Egbert Figgemeier is a scholar working on Electrical and Electronic Engineering, Automotive Engineering, Materials Chemistry, Electronic, Optical and Magnetic Materials and Renewable Energy, Sustainability and the Environment, having authored 85 papers that have together received 3.2k indexed citations. Recurring topics across this work include Advancements in Battery Materials (44 papers), Advanced Battery Materials and Technologies (40 papers), Advanced Battery Technologies Research (35 papers), TiO2 Photocatalysis and Solar Cells (11 papers), Electrochemical Analysis and Applications (10 papers), Conducting polymers and applications (9 papers), Metal complexes synthesis and properties (8 papers) and Supercapacitor Materials and Fabrication (6 papers). The work is most often cited by research in Automotive Engineering (1.2k citations), Electrical and Electronic Engineering (2.2k citations), Electronic, Optical and Magnetic Materials (521 citations), Renewable Energy, Sustainability and the Environment (396 citations) and Electrochemistry (106 citations). Egbert Figgemeier has collaborated with scholars based in Germany, Switzerland and Ethiopia. Frequent co-authors include Gebrekidan Gebresilassie Eshetu, Michel Armand, Heng Zhang, Anders Hagfeldt, Dirk Uwe Sauer, Edwin C. Constable, Catherine E. Housecroft, Stefano Passerini, Xabier Júdez and Henry Adenusi. Their work appears in journals such as Journal of The Electrochemical Society, Journal of Energy Storage, Advanced Materials Interfaces, Chemical Communications and Journal of Power Sources.
